Ayuba sympathises with people of Isolo Kingdom on demise of Monarch

…says Monarch’s death left a huge vacuum.

Late Osolo of Isolo Kingdom, Lagos State, HRM Oba Kabiru Alani Adelaja Agbabiaka, Adeola Olushi III

THE Deputy Chairman of the House Committee on Interior and the Member of the House of Representatives representing the Alimosho Federal Constituency, Hon. Ganiyu Adele Ayuba (Mayor KK) has mourned the late Osolo of Isolo Kingdom, Lagos State, HRM Oba Kabiru Alani Adelaja Agbabiaka, Adeola Olushi III, who joined his ancestors on April 10, 2024.

Ayuba said in a statement, "I received with shock and utter dismay the news of the transition of the paramount ruler of Isolo Kingdom, Lagos State, HRM Oba Kabiru Alani Adelaja Agbabiaka, Adeola Olushi III.

"I extend my deepest sympathy and heartfelt condolences to the late Osolo family, his friends, associates, the Yoruba-Awori race and people of Isolo Kingdom, the Lagos State Council of Obas and Chiefs, of which Oba Kabiru was the secretary, as well as the Government of Isolo Local Council Development Area and Lagos State on the departure of the monarch.4486

"The late highly revered monarch was an inspirational first-class traditional ruler, who rendered worthy service to his people and country, as well as contributed to the tremendous transformation and development of his community and Lagos State as a whole.

"The quintessential monarch left a huge vacuum. He was a good custodian and an exemplar of Yoruba culture and tradition. He will long be remembered for his wisdom, wealth of experience, and worthy and dedicated services to his community and the environs.

"I pray for the repose of the soul of the deceased. May God accept Kabiyesi’s soul into Aljanah Firdaus and uphold everyone and everything he left behind."
